Yeah, I have given out bitcoin as gifts before, and it doesn't really seem to be very appreciated for most people who are not already into it, and even if they are kind of into it, it may not be a very good gift.

Probably, bitcoin is a decent gift to give merely for someone who is interested and not connected with any special occasion beyond merely attempting to introduce them to bitcoin because they are acting as if they are interested in bitcoin.

Even just giving some out, I have had mixed reaction. I'm sure when it's all over the news outlets and passing an ATH people would be more inclined to appreciate it. I have friends who took it and didn't do anything with it, and others who didn't even want to take the time to DL a wallet on their phone for me to send them $10-$15 worth...

I'll take some for xmas though!


Actually, I sent several through Circle, ranging between $5 and $40 (mostly $5), and one time about a year ago, I requested that I receive several of them back from Circle, because they looked like they had not been processed.  Circle said that they could only reverse the ones that had not been opened in the e-mail, but if the e-mail had been opened, then they could not reverse it.
